Description

Describe the bug
I am using Image v3.4.0 , I used drawLine to draw lines, it has always been 1px

The same result was obtained using the DrawPixelLine of https://github.com/Intervention/image/issues/1298

Code Example

$image->drawLine(function (LineFactory $line)use($listHeight) {
    $line->from(980, 20); // starting point of line
    $line->to(980, $listHeight-20); // ending point
    $line->color('#723e4b'); // color of line
    $line->width(5); // line width in pixels
});

Images
test

Environment (please complete the following information):

  • PHP Version: PHP 8.1.25 (cli)
  • OS: windows
  • Intervention Image Version: v3.4.0
  • GD or Imagick: GD
gd

GD Support => enabled
GD Version => bundled (2.1.0 compatible)
